All votes are public, they’re literally broadcast to the Fediverse writ large. You vote on something on your server, your server then tells the server owning the thing you voted on and that server then tells anyone who is interested (subscribers on other servers). That way everyone knows that this comment was voted on, but that information is indelibly tied to you - an entity on the Fediverse.
Lemmy devs just chose not to a) show that information in a UI (plenty of other software out there does) and b) not inform people that was the case. Which leads to the whole point of the thread, hiding this from users merely gives a false sense of security.

It’s the multiple volumes that are throwing it.
You want to mount the drive at /media/HDD1:/media
or something like that and configure Radarr to use /media/movies
and /media/downloads
as it’s storage locations.
Hardlinks only work on the same volume, which technically they are, but the environment inside the container has no way of knowing that.

People expect, that, like most other services, docker binds to ports/addresses behind the firewall
Unless you tell it otherwise that’s exactly what it does. If you don’t bind ports good luck accessing your NAT’d 172.17.0.x:3001 service from the internet. Podman has the exact same functionality.
But… You literally have ports rules in there. Rules that expose ports.
You don’t get to grumble that docker is doing something when you’re telling it to do it
Dockers manipulation of nftables is pretty well defined in their documentation. If you dig deep everything is tagged and natted through to the docker internal networks.
As to the usage of the docker socket that is widely advised against unless you really know what you’re doing.
